Как заблокировать отдельные строки в Excel

Работа с большими массивами данных в электронных таблицах часто превращается в хаос, когда заголовки столбцов или важные справочные строки исчезают из виду при прокрутке вниз. Это не просто неудобно, но и чревато ошибками, так как пользователь теряет контекст, к какой именно категории относятся отображаемые цифры. Чтобы избежать путаницы, необходимо зафиксировать определенную область экрана, оставив ее статичной независимо от положения ползунка.

Функция закрепления позволяет «прибить» к верхнему или левому краю окна одну или несколько строк и столбцов. Закрепление областей — это стандартный инструмент интерфейса, который не требует написания макросов или сложных формул. В этой статье мы разберем все нюансы работы с этим функционалом, включая скрытые возможности и частые ошибки.

Рассмотрим различные сценарии: от простой фиксации первой строки до сложного разделения экрана на четыре независимых окна. Понимание логики работы курсора и выделений здесь играет решающую роль. Если вы научитесь правильно управлять видимостью, ваша продуктивность вырастет, а работа с отчетами станет значительно комфортнее.

Базовое закрепление первой строки и столбца

Самый простой и распространенный сценарий использования — это фиксация шапки таблицы, то есть первой строки. Это необходимо, чтобы названия колонок всегда оставались на виду. Для реализации этого действия в ленте меню следует перейти на вкладку Вид и найти группу Окно. Там расположена кнопка Закрепить области, при нажатии на которую выпадет список опций.

Выберите пункт Закрепить верхнюю строку. После этого действия появится тонкая серая линия под первой строкой, указывающая на границу закрепленной зоны. Теперь при прокрутке вниз заголовки останутся на месте, а данные будут двигаться под ними. Это базовое решение подходит для 90% стандартных отчетов.

  • 📌 Нажмите Вид в верхнем меню программы.
  • 📌 Выберите опцию Закрепить области.
  • 📌 Кликните Закрепить верхнюю строку для фиксации заголовка.
  • 📌 Используйте Закрепить первый столбец, если нужно зафиксировать крайнюю левую колонку.

Аналогично работает механизм для первого столбца. Если ваша таблица очень широкая и имеет множество полей, фиксация крайнего левого столбца (обычно содержащего номера строк или имена объектов) позволяет не терять ориентацию при горизонтальной прокрутке. Важно понимать, что эти два действия (верхняя строка и первый столбец) являютсякими командами, которые работают только для первой позиции.

⚠️ Внимание: Если вы выберете опцию закрепления верхней строки, а затем попытаетесь закрепить первый столбец, первое действие будет отменено. Программа позволяет использовать только один тип автоматического закрепления одновременно, если не используется ручная настройка.

Ручная настройка закрепления произвольных строк

Часто возникает ситуация, когда шапка таблицы занимает не одну, а две или три строки, либо необходимо зафиксировать область, начинающуюся не с самого верха. Стандартные кнопки здесь не помогут, и требуется ручная настройка. Логика Excel в этом случае строится на позиции активного курсора. Чтобы закрепить, например, первые три строки, вам нужно выделить четвертую строку целиком.

Сделайте это, кликнув по номеру строки 4 в левой части экрана. Важно выделить именно всю строку, а не одну ячейку, хотя выделение ячейки A4 также сработает, так как программа ориентируется на левую верхнюю границу выделенной области. После того как строка подсвечена, снова перейдите в меню Вид и выберите Закрепить области, но на этот раз кликните самый верхний пункт — Закрепить области.

☑️ Проверка перед закреплением

Выполнено: 0 / 4

Результатом станет появление разделительной линии под третьей строкой. Все, что находится выше этой линии, теперь зафиксировано. Если вам нужно закрепить и строки, и столбцы одновременно, принцип остается тем же: выделите ячейку, которая находится справа и снизу от области, которую планируете зафиксировать. Например, для закрепления первых двух строк и первого столбца, выделите ячейку B3.

Этот метод дает полный контроль над интерфейсом. Вы можете оставить видимыми любые справочные данные, коэффициенты пересчета или даты периода, расположив их в верхних строках листа. Главное — помнить правило: линия закрепления всегда проходит по верхнему и левому краю выделенной ячейки.

Разделение окна на независимые области

Помимо жесткого закрепления, в Excel существует более гибкий инструмент — Разделить. В отличие от закрепления, которое фиксирует область и скрывает ее при прокрутке, разделение создает подвижные панели прокрутки. Экран делится на две или четыре независимые части, каждая из которых может отображать любой участок листа. Это полезно, когда нужно сравнить данные из начала и конца длинного списка.

Для активации режима перейдите на вкладку Вид и нажмите кнопку Разделить. На экране появятся серые двойные линии, делящие окно на квадранты. Вы можете перетаскивать эти разделители мышью, изменяя пропорции окон. В каждой созданной области будет свой собственный ползунок прокрутки, что позволяет, например, в верхнем окне держать вид на строку 100, а в нижнем — прокручивать строки с 500 по 600.

Функция Закрепление областей Разделить
Тип фиксации Жесткая (статичная) Подвижная (динамическая)
Ползунки прокрутки Один общий для свободной зоны Отдельные для каждой панели
Количество частей Две (фиксированная и рабочая) До четырех независимых
Удаление Снять закрепление Убрать разделение

Использование разделения особенно актуально при сверке данных или переносе информации. Вы можете видеть исходник в одной части экрана и результат в другой. Однако стоит помнить, что при печати документа настройки разделения не сохраняются и не влияют на вывод на бумагу, в отличие от настроек печати, которые задаются отдельно.

📊 Какой инструмент вы используете чаще?
Закрепление верхней строки
Ручное закрепление областей
Разделение окна
Вообще не использую

Скрытие строк как альтернатива блокировке

Иногда пользователи путают понятия «закрепить» и «скрыть». Если ваша цель — не зафиксировать строку на экране, а временно убрать лишние данные из вида, чтобы они не мешали, используется функция скрытия. Это не блокирует строку от прокрутки, а полностью исключает ее из отображаемой области. Для этого нужно выделить строки, нажать правую кнопку мыши и выбрать Скрыть.

Скрытые строки имеют свои особенности навигации. Нумерация строк в этом случае прерывается (например, идет сразу после 5-й строки 8-я), что служит визуальным индикатором наличия скрытых данных. Чтобы вернуть их, необходимо выделить диапазон, включающий скрытые строки (например, с 5-й по 8-ю), и выбрать Отобразить в контекстном меню.

Скрытие часто применяют для защиты формул или промежуточных расчетов, которые не нужны для финального анализа. Однако, в отличие от закрепления, скрытие может быть снято любым пользователем, имеющим доступ к файлу, если лист не защищен паролем. Поэтому для конфиденциальности этот метод подходит слабо, но для организации рабочего пространства — отлично.

⚠️ Внимание: При копировании диапазона ячеек, содержащего скрытые строки, Excel по умолчанию копирует и их содержимое тоже. Если вы скопируете видимую часть и вставите в другое место, скрытые данные могут unexpectedly появиться там. Используйте Выделить только видимые ячейки (горячие клавиши Alt +;), чтобы избежать этого.

Защита листа и блокировка редактирования

Слово «заблокировать» в контексте Excel часто понимают как «запретить редактирование». Если ваша задача — сделать так, чтобы строки нельзя было изменить, удалить или сдвинуть, необходимо использовать защиту листа. По умолчанию все ячейки в Excel имеют статус Защищаемая, но этот статус не работает, пока не включена защита всего листа.

Чтобы разрешить редактирование только определенных строк, сначала снимите блокировку с нужных ячеек. Выделите диапазон, который пользователи смогут менять, нажмите Ctrl + 1 для открытия формата ячеек, перейдите на вкладку Защита и снимите галочку Защищаемая ячейка. После этого переходите на вкладку Рецензирование и выбирайте Защитить лист.

В открывшемся окне можно задать пароль (опционально) и выбрать список действий, которые разрешено выполнять пользователю. Например, можно разрешить сортировку или использование автофильтров, но запретить удаление строк. Это создает надежный барьер для случайного или преднамеренного повреждения структуры таблицы.

Что делать, если забыт пароль?

Если вы забыли пароль для снятия защиты листа, восстановить данные стандартными средствами Excel невозможно. Файлы с забытыми паролями защиты листов часто становятся недоступными для редактирования. Рекомендуется хранить пароли в менеджере паролей или использовать сложные, но запоминающиеся комбинации. Для файлов без критической важности существуют сторонние утилиты для подбора, но они не гарантируют успех.

Устранение проблем и часто задаваемые вопросы

Несмотря на простоту интерфейса, пользователи часто сталкиваются с типичными проблемами. Например, кнопка Закрепить области может быть неактивна (серого цвета). Это происходит, если вы находитесь в режиме редактирования ячейки (мигает курсор ввода) или если таблица оформлена как Умная таблица (объект Таблица через Ctrl + T). В случае с умными таблицами заголовки закрепляются автоматически при прокрутке, и ручное закрепление не требуется.

Еще одна частая ошибка — попытка закрепить строки, когда открыто несколько окон одного файла. Функция закрепления работает только в активном окне. Если вы разделили окно на части, закрепление будет действовать внутри каждой части независимо, что может запутать новичка. Всегда проверяйте, в каком именно окне или панели вы работаете.

Для быстрого снятия всех закреплений и разделений используйте команду Снять закрепление областей в том же меню Вид. Это вернет интерфейс в исходное состояние, где прокручивается весь лист целиком. Регулярная тренировка этих навыков позволит вам чувствовать себя уверенно даже в самых громоздких финансовых отчетах.

Почему не работает закрепление строк в Excel?

Чаще всего причина кроется в режиме редактирования ячейки. Если вы начали вводить текст в клетку, многие функции меню блокируются. Нажмите Enter или Esc, чтобы выйти из режима редактирования. Вторая причина — файл может быть в режиме совместимости или защищен от изменений структурой книги.

Как закрепить строки сразу на нескольких листах?

Автоматически закрепить строки на всех листах сразу одной кнопкой нельзя. Однако можно выделить все листы (группировку), кликнув правой кнопкой по ярлычку листа и выбрав Выделить все листы. Затем примените закрепление. Оно применится ко всем выбранным листам одновременно. Не забудьте разгруппировать листы после этого, кликнув по ярлычку правой кнопкой и выбрав Разгруппировать листы.

Сохраняется ли закрепление при экспорте в PDF?

Нет, при сохранении файла в формат PDF или при печати настройки закрепления областей игнорируются, так как PDF — это статичный формат. Однако, если вы настроите параметры печати так, чтобы заголовки повторялись на каждой странице (вкладка Разметка страницы -> Печатать заголовки), то в печатной версии заголовки будут на каждом листе.